I believe I seeded this back about '05. A fine sounding set and great performance to compliment the sudden tide of Spacemen 3 fathered bands being seeded right now. It came from silvers, bought about '98, and is a gem in the small field of soundboard or broadcast-quality shows available from J Spaceman & Company. There are no changes from the original seed. Artwork (sparse) is included. My upload is capped at about 44k: please be patient and help seed when you're done...


Spiritualized
Peel Sessions
Oxford Sound Studios
London, UK
October 29, 1997*


FM**>??>Silver CD 'Spaced Out'>EAC>FLAC(8)
Quality 9/10; A

Liberated Bootleg: "Spaced Out" (no other info); Artwork Included

1) Oh Happy Day
2) Shine a Light
3) Electric Mainline
4) Electricity
5) Come Together
6) I Think I'm in Love
7) Cop Shoot Cop

Later with Jools Holland: (filler on original disc)

8) Come Together
9) Broken Heart
10) Oh Happy Day

* Believed to be this date. Peel/Lamacq broadcast of the launch of Oxford Sound Studios 10/27/97-10/30/97. A series broadcast on BBC 1. Spiritualized performed on the 29th. See: http://www.vheissu.freeserve.co.uk/p1997.html
**Artwork says: "Soundboard Recording" however, there is no music above 16K, when spectrum analyzed, which clearly indicates FM source. Quality is OUTSTANDING for FM.
